Who doesn't enjoy milkshakes? Milkshakes are the universal throughout hot summer season days and make outstanding treats for those who prefer drinking rather that consuming snacks. How can you make healthy milkshakes to suppress those yearnings?™The recipes are different, but let's start with the basics. Buy yourself a good blender, it should not be that costly and you can get it from any warehouse store. A simple milkshake depends upon your choices, do you like apples? Simulate oranges? Do you like strawberries? Whatever you choice is, you can merely throw in the ingredients with two cups of skimmed milk - tastes much better - and you'll have a milkshake in no time. Another method to do it, if it's really hot, is to get low-fat ice-cream and include it to the mix. If you're a fan of nuts, you can chop them up and include them to the milkshake.

For those bodybuilding, you can constantly add protein powder and a number of egg whites for optimum results. ; for such a milkshake, make sure you keep it in the refrigerator and don't consume it after two days - you do not want to run the risk of the eggs going bad.

You can constantly try various variations with ice rather of ice-cream; it offers it a crunchier feeling. An old trick some chefs utilized was to add a little bit of ginger, considering that ginger makes almost anything taste great. Some individuals prefer vegetable shakes to milkshakes; you can constantly put your vegetables in the blender according to your preference. Such shakes are ideal for those with ulcers and stomach conditions.

If you're the sort of individual who can't stand anything unsweetened, you can attempt adding a teaspoon of honey; it adds fewer calories than putting actual sugar. Other additions such adding a teaspoon of coffee or any other stimulant need to be done with care, and always remember to keep your shakes and milkshakes within the borders of you diet for ultimate success.

The egg is a nutrient-dense food, consisting of high quality protein and a vast array of vital vitamins, minerals and micronutrient.

As a whole food, eggs are an inexpensive and low calorie source of nutrients such as folate, riboflavin, selenium, lecithin and vitamins B-12 and A. Eggs are also among the couple of exogenous sources of vitamins K and D. Furthermore, whole eggs are a complete source of proteins as it contains all the essential amino acids needed by the human body. Eggs were discovered to have lower amino acid material compared with beef, the biological worth of egg protein is higher. The protein source from eggs are good for the advancement of skeletal muscle and egg protein is extensively utilized by professional athletes to increase muscle mass.

All of us know the health benefits of omega-3 fats specifically eicosapentaenoic acid (EPA) and docosahexaenoic acid (DHA), connected with a lowered threat of heart disease (CVD) and mortality from heart diseases. Low levels of DHA have actually been associated with Alzheimer's disease. Chicken feed is now enriched with omega-3 to increase the omega-3 levels in their eggs. Usage of DHA-enriched eggs can greatly improve current dietary DHA intakes from non-fish sources and help technique or surpass advised intakes for optimum human health.

Eggs had fallen in and out of favour through the years mainly due to the understanding of cholesterol-rich eggs as a "prohibited food" developed in action to the extremely publicized 1970s recommendation by the American Heart Association (AHA) to restrict egg intake and limitation dietary cholesterol intake to 300 mg/d. The dietary cholesterol standards are similar in the most recent AHA report; however, their position relating to egg intake has ended up being more specific. It was specified the intake of one yolk a day is acceptable, if other cholesterol contributing foods were limited in the diet plan. An egg includes 212 milligrams of cholesterol, dietary cholesterol has less of an effect on blood cholesterol than once believed. Cholesterol is a dietary component that has generated much public and clinical interest in combination with CHD but extensive research study has stopped working to establish a definite link between dietary cholesterol intake and disease progression. A recent evaluation of years of research has actually concluded that healthy adults can enjoy eggs without CVD. Many conclusions can be made about the ill-effects of eating eggs but these have to be taken with care. For example, one study concluded that eggs were linked to increased threat of Type 2 diabetes however this was not the real story as the result of symptom of this disease was the involved bad nutrition, mainly sausages and bacon taken with eggs in the people tested. The truth of the situation is that although egg intake has gradually declined since the original recommendations in the 1970s, CHD and Type 2 diabetes in addition to weight problems are still the leading causes of death in the U.S. today.

Eggs have actually been getting some attention for their function in preserving eye health and possibly assisting prevent age related macular degeneration (AMD), the leading cause of irreparable loss of sight in the United States. This condition establishes from long-lasting oxidative damage brought on by the exposure of the eye to intense light. Current research has actually shown the worth of lutein, a natural pigment or carotenoid in egg yolks. Lutein and zeaxanthin collect in the macularregion of the retina for that reason, since of their chemical homes; these two carotenoids might operate to lower the risk for development of AMD. Epidemiological research studies support the fact that those individuals who took in a greater number of foods abundant in lutein and zeaxanthin had a lower threat for AMD. Even though eggs include less lutein than leafy greens, the lutein in eggs is more easily soaked up. One yolk has actually been found to offer between 200 and 300 micrograms of these carotenoids. In a study that measured the total carotenoid material of several foods, lutein represented 15-47/100 parts of the total carotenoid found in various dark green leafy veggies, whereas eggs were discovered to consist of 54/100 parts. This recommends that a person would benefit more by consuming an egg than getting lutein from other sources. Lutein and zeaxanthin are likewise classed as antioxidants and their intake also might be connected with a reduction in the risk for rheumatoid arthritis, CHD and persistent diseases such as cancer.

Eggs consist of many of the minerals that the body needs for health. In specific eggs are abundant in choline, a vital nutrient required for the typical functioning of all cells. It is particularly crucial for appropriate liver, brain and neural network, memory advancement and even in inflammation for this reason reducing threat of heart problem and breast cancer. The prospective public health implications of not consuming enough of this vital nutrient have only just recently started to be taken a look at. There is a substantial variation in the dietary requirement for choline. When fed a choline-deficient diet plan, some males and females established fatty liver and liver and muscle damage, whereas others did not. This brings in a genetic irregularity to the requirement of dietary choline. It is strongly advised not just for kids but also for moms-to-be as eggs are a concentrated source of choline without the added calories. To get the exact same amount of choline found in a single egg (125 mg/72 calories; the majority of the choline remains in the egg yolk - 680 mg/100g), one would need to take in 3 1/4 cups of milk (270 calories) or 3 1/2 ounces of wheat germ (366 calories).

Regardless of all their favorable features, eggs sometimes are linked to food security issues. They do need to be stored and handled properly. Eating raw eggs is ruled out safe due to the fact that eggs may consist of salmonella, a kind of bacteria that especially is dangerous for the extremely young, old and immune-compromised. In cases where raw egg is required in a dish, guarantee that it is pasteurised.
